Becoming a parent and having a baby do not happen through nature’s own way for all families. However, medical science has made this possible through other means. While IUI, fertility drugs and adoption might be some of the alternate options, surrogacy has gained immense popularity in the recent past. Having babies through surrogacy has become a common thing in India, not just among couples who have tried hard and failed, but among celebs too.
The most recent actor to join the bandwagon of celebrities who opted for surrogacy was the Bollywood star Tusshar Kapoor. The Kapoor boy, despite being single and having no history of past affairs, took a bold step and had a baby through IVF.
Well, he is not the first on the list though! Here’s a look at other Bollywood and Hollywood celebrities, who had babies through surrogacy.

Aamir Khan and Kiran Rao
Aamir believes in taking the road less travelled and his decision of having a surrogate baby did not shock his fans too much. The actor already has a son (Junaid) and a daughter (Ira) with his first wife Reena Dutta. When Aamir divorced Reena and married Kiran, the couple was disheartened by Kiran’s miscarriage and decided to go the IVF way. It was then that they were blessed with baby Azad Rao Khan!

Sarah Jessica Parker and Matthew BroderickÂ
American actress Sarah Jessica Parker, who is well known for her leading role as Carrie Bradshaw in Sex and the City, had her first son in 2002. However, the couple experienced several difficulties when they tried to have their second baby and so decided to go ahead with a surrogate. Sarah and Matthew were blessed with twin daughters – Marion Loretta Elwell and Tabitha Hodge Broderick, who were born to a surrogate mother in Ohio.

Nicole Kidman and Keith UrbanÂ
Nicole and her husband Keith, opted to the surrogate way and were blessed with a baby girl – Faith Margaret, in 2011. They also have another daughter named Sunday Rose.

Elizabeth Banks
After years of unsuccessful attempts at becoming a parent, Elizabeth and her husband Max Handelman, decided to take the surrogate route to expand their family. Felix and Magnus, her two adorable gestational sons were born in 2011 and 2012 respectively.

Michael Jackson
Did you know the King of Pop, late Michael Jackson also went the surrogate way? Yes, Michael has two biological kids – Prince and Paris, with his ex-wife Debbie Rowe. He then had his youngest son Blanket via surrogacy.

Ricky Martin
The sensational singer Ricky Martin also opted to have kids through surrogacy. A single father, Ricky has his twin sons Matteo and Valentino in 2008 via surrogacy.
